Why raspberries won't let dry

The water content of raspberries is over 80 percent. When the fruit is dried, the water is completely removed. Ultimately, only the shells and kernels remain.

To eat dried raspberries, you'd have to soak them in water. The fruits then taste very weak and have a bitter aftertaste. Many of the valuable ingredients are lost during drying.

Drying raspberry seeds

If you make jelly from raspberries, you must first pass the fruit through a sieve to remove the stones.

A tasty condiment can be made from the kernels left in the sieve. To do this, spread out the seeds and let them dry in the oven or in the sun.

You can tell that the kernels are well dried out because they become very hard. Finely paint them in a coffee grinder or similar device. Then mix the powder with salt. With this mixture, fish utensils can be very well seasoned.

This is how you can preserve raspberries:

Raspberries don't last long to store. Even under the best of circumstances, they become inedible after a day or two.

Have more fruit harvestedthan you can eat or consume raw, you need to process them asap.

Alternatives to drying

Instead of drying raspberries, you have other alternatives to preserve raspberries for several months. You can:

  • As a compote boil down
  • Freeze
  • Process into jam or jelly
  • Make raspberry purée

The fruits do not lose so much water during this preparation process. The ingredients, especially the minerals, are retained.

Even if the fruits of the raspberries cannot be dried, this does not apply to the leaves. Gather young raspberry leaves, crush them and lay them out to dry. A great-tasting tea can be made from it. It is said to have a beneficial effect on women’s ailments.
